description Product Description
This chemical is primarily used in organic synthesis as a key intermediate for the preparation of complex carbohydrates and glycoconjugates. It is particularly valuable in glycosylation reactions, where it serves as a glycosyl donor to introduce galactose units into various molecules. This is crucial in the development of oligosaccharides, glycoproteins, and glycolipids, which have significant roles in biological processes and pharmaceutical research. Additionally, it is employed in the synthesis of glycosides and other sugar derivatives, which are important in drug discovery and the study of carbohydrate-protein interactions. Its acetyl groups provide stability and facilitate selective reactions, making it a versatile reagent in carbohydrate chemistry.
